What companies run services between Woonona, NSW, Australia and Bomaderry (Station), NSW, Australia?

You can take a train from Woonona Station to Bomaderry Station via Wollongong Station and Kiama Station in around 2h 5m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Princes Hwy After Gray St to Bomaderry via Princes Hwy Before Campbell St and Wollongong in around 3h 27m.
